Lines Matching defs:flags
129 static void sa_add(struct proc *pp, caddr_t addr, size_t len, ulong_t flags,
145 * Setting ism_off turns off the SHM_SHARE_MMU flag from the flags passed to
265 int flags = (uflags & SHMAT_VALID_FLAGS_MASK);
274 if ((flags & SHM_RDONLY) == 0 &&
277 if (spt_invalid(flags)) {
282 flags = flags & ~SHM_SHARE_MMU;
284 flags = flags & ~SHM_PAGEABLE;
285 flags = flags | SHM_SHARE_MMU;
287 useISM = (spt_locked(flags) || spt_pageable(flags));
291 uint_t newsptflags = flags | spt_flags(sp->shm_sptseg);
295 * validation of flags needs to be done after the effect of
458 flags, share_szc);
489 if (flags & SHM_RDONLY)
505 if (flags & SHM_RND)
546 crargs.flags = 0;
1026 sa_add(struct proc *pp, caddr_t addr, size_t len, ulong_t flags, kshmid_t *id)
1035 nsap->sa_flags = flags;
1183 crargs.flags = 0;